TLU/Rakvere is a professional volleyball team based in Rakvere, Estonia. The team was founded in 2018 and has quickly become one of the top teams in the Estonian Volleyball League. The team is known for its strong defense and aggressive offense, which has helped them win numerous matches and tournaments.

The team is made up of talented and experienced players from Estonia and other countries. The team's captain is Kert Toobal, a skilled setter who has played for the Estonian national team. Other key players include outside hitter Oliver Orav, middle blocker Rait Rikberg, and libero Rait Klaas.

TLU/Rakvere is coached by Rainer Vassiljev, a former professional volleyball player who has coached several successful teams in Estonia. Under his leadership, the team has developed a strong team spirit and a winning mentality.

The team's home court is the Rakvere Spordihall, a modern and spacious arena that can accommodate thousands of fans. TLU/Rakvere has a large and passionate fan base, who come out to support the team at every match.
